Just because a real Keepon is too expensive for anyone to afford doesn’t mean that it’s not possible to make one for yourself, and it doesn’t even have to be (technically) edible. Limitless Boredom created their very own astonishingly similar DIY Keepon out of a bunch of R/C helicopter parts, CrabFu style. Seriously, it’s such a good reproduction that it makes me wonder where that $30k really goes…

By way of comparison, after the jump you can watch a video of a pair of Keepons dancing with HOAP-3 at the ICRA ‘08 Human-Robot Interaction Challenge.
